Job Description
We are currently recruiting for two experienced Project Engineers to support a major long-term project closure programme. This is an excellent opportunity for candidates with strong Quality Assurance and project engineering experience to join a well-established team working on the safe and compliant close-out of a complex engineering project. The role involves documentation control, compliance, reporting, and ensuring all project records are complete and accurate ahead of final handover to operations. Candidates should have QA experience, attention to detail, and background in regulated engineering environments such as Mechanical, Electrical, Civil, or C&I, with knowledge of engineering standards, risk assessment, contract management, and CDM regulations.

Job Details
Responsibilities
- Support project closure and operational handover activities
- Ensure all engineering and quality documentation is complete, accurate, and compliant
- Review commissioning reports, compliance schedules, and project records
- Update Health & Safety documentation and reports
- Coordinate project documentation and configuration control activities
- Support production of project execution plans and engineering documentation
- Assist with design, commissioning, and decommissioning activities
- Review contractor method statements, risk assessments, and work instructions
- Provide technical oversight to ensure compliance with engineering standards and design intent
- Support project delivery across multidisciplinary engineering teams
- Liaise with st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le
- Conduct quality checks and support continuous improvement initiatives
- Participate in root cause analysis and lessons learned activities
Requirements
- Previous Quality Assurance experience
- Strong attention to detail
- Experience working in a disciplined engineering environment such as Mechanical, Electrical, Civil, or C&I
- Background in industrial plant, energy, utilities, nuclear, or heavy engineering projects
- Experience supporting engineering project delivery
- Understanding of engineering standards and compliance processes
- Knowledge of risk assessment methodologies and safe systems of work
- Experience with contract management and project coordination
- Familiarity with CDM regulations and engineering documentation processes
